Having great coverage makes your drive that much more enjoyable. Here’s what Wheel and Tire Protection has to offer:

  • Covers replacement of a tire if structurally damaged by a covered road hazard, such as glass, potholes, debris, rocks, nails, etc. (includes tires with run-flat technology)

 

  • Tire replacement coverage applies to the original tires and new tires installed under the agreement, if they meet the manufacturer’s size specifications

 

  • Covers replacement of the wheel if covered road hazard damage prevents the tire from sealing to the wheel or maintaining the tire manufacturer’s air pressure specifications

 

  • Wheel replacement coverage applies to the original wheels and new wheels installed under the agreement, if they meet the manufacturer’s size specifications

 

  • Covers approved costs related to the replacement of tires or wheels including taxes, labor, mounting and balancing, valve stems, and environmental/disposal fees

 

  • Covers cosmetic wheel repair for eligible scrapes, scratches and other repairable cosmetic damage to an alloy wheel, limited to a total of four (4) individual wheel repairs if the agreement term is 60 months or less, or a total of eight (8) individual wheel repairs if the agreement term is 61 months or more

 

  • Towing reimbursement, up to $100 per occurrence, if required due to covered road hazard damage

 

  • Rental car reimbursement for up to two (2) days, at $50 per day ($100 maximum benefit), in the event that a vehicle inspection is required or a covered repair requires shipment of damaged wheels

 

  • Repairs performed at any participating Mercedes-Benz Dealership or other authorized repair facility

 

  • Transferable from consumer to consumer in a private vehicle sale, or in a lease agreement transfer and assumption, for a $40 transfer fee

 

  • Available on New, Certified Pre-Owned, or Pre-Owned Mercedes-Benz vehicles and vans

Coverage information:

To purchase or learn more, please visit Mercedes-Benz of Marion. A $50 deductible per replaced tire and a $100 deductible per replaced wheel may apply. There is no deductible for cosmetic wheel repairs

  • Aggregate claim limits for replacement claims may exist according to the term of the agreement

 

  • Cosmetic wheel coverage is limited to a total of four (4) individual wheel repairs if the agreement term is 60 months or less, or a total of eight (8) individual wheel repairs if the agreement term is 61 months or more

 

  • Cosmetic wheel repair is limited to sanding, painting, or refinishing the wheel without the need to apply additional material or bend/straighten the wheel and only applies to factory wheel-brushed or painted surfaces.

 

  • Prior claim authorization required

 

  • Comprehensive coverage:
  • No mileage limitations
  • Coverage exclusions may apply:
    Damage to tires with less than 3/32” tread depth at the lowest point on the tire at the time of damage

 

  • Cosmetic damage to tires

 

  • Damage caused by vandalism

 

  • Replacements/repairs made without prior authorization

 

  • Damage caused by road conditions (such as uneven lanes or metal plates) found in construction zones or construction sites

 

  • Damage resulting from failure to perform routine tire maintenance, including alignments, rotations and balancings, and failures from normal wear and tear, improper wear, or dry rot
